The Role


To provide all necessary help and support to passengers as required by our customer airlines which may include check in, baggage processing, reservations and ticketing, boarding of flights, air-bridge operation, greeting arriving passengers, handling of VIPs, provide special passenger assistance, handle customer complaints and other duties as assigned.

The Arrivals Agent role is varied and challenging, day to day you'll be responsible for:

  • Assisting passengers as needed through arrival and check in processes including support for passengers with special requirements such as unaccompanied minors (UM), VIP passengers and passengers needing wheelchair assistance
  • Directing passengers through Customs, Immigration, and quarantine as required
  • Making public address announcements as required
  • Assisting colleagues in other areas of the airport to ensure that wheelchairs, strollers and bags etc remain with the passengers upon arrival
  • Comply with all UK/Ireland/EU legislation as well as airport authority and carrier security requirements
  • Comply with BIA Handling Ltd Standard Operating Procedures (SOP's)
  • Maintain the highest standards of safety and security always
  • Aircraft Cleaning
  • Other duties as assigned
